![]() |
【转帖】用vb 和 vb.net 进行cad二次开发有什么区别?
用vb 和 vb.net 进行cad二次开发有什么区别?
www.dimcax.com 用vb 和 vb.net 进行cad二次开发有什么区别? 用vb 和 vb.net 进行cad二次开发有什么区别? public sub newdwg() dim acaddoc as autodesk.autocad.interop.acaddocument '连接cad文档 dim acadapp as autodesk.autocad.interop.acadapplication '连接cad环境 ' 连接至 autocad 应用程序 try ' 可能导致异常的代码 acadapp = getobject(, "autocad.application.17") catch ' 当异常发生时处理异常的代码 err.clear() try acadapp = createobject("autocad.application.17") catch msgbox(err.description) exit sub end try finally ' 清理现场 end try ' 连接至 autocad 图形 acaddoc = acadapp.activedocument acadapp.visible = true '========================================================== '新建dwg文件 try acaddoc = acadapp.application.documents.add acaddoc.saveas("f:\houlinbo.dwg") 'acaddoc.close() 'acaddoc.application.documents.open("f:\houlinbo.dwg", false) catch end try end sub |
所有的时间均为北京时间。 现在的时间是 02:12 PM. |